More Court By Bravo Sylvester Stallone V. Mohamed Hadid

April 2, 2013 by tamaratattles 12 Comments

mohamedHere is a court case I so want to see televised…Lisa’s Vanderpump’s buddy Mohamed Hadid is being sued by Sylvester Stallone. Sly’s case is basically that Mohamed is a crappy contractor and he messed up his house. He’s suing for $1.4 million in damages.

Mohamed has filed for a temporary restraining order against Sly saying that he has threatened his life and pushed him.

According to TMZ:
“Hadid claims in his new legal docs (that) while he was working on Sly’s house, he witnessed the actor fly into fits of  rage, at times grabbing his dog by the neck and throwing it into its  crib. Hadid also claims Sly threatened to smash his head in with a  baseball bat. Hadid says Sly once  said, ‘Get these dirty Mexicans out of here or I will blow your head  off.'”

TMZ also quotes Sly’s lawyer, Marty Singer, who said “the actor was never notified of a hearing for a restraining order, adding Sly’s trial is about  to begin and this is just a desperate attempt to smear him.  Singer says he  took Hadid’s deposition last week and asked about all the conversations he had  with Sly — and no threats were ever mentioned. Singer says, “This is a  desperate attempt by a man who wants to be a media star, which is why he’s a  guest star on ‘Shahs of Sunset.'”
